is a classic Yoruba gospel song by Pastor J. A. Adelakun (Ayewa Gospel Music Ministry), originally released as part of his evergreen hits. The title translates roughly to "Jesus is the one who helps me carry my burden," and the song is widely used as a prayerful anthem for strength and divine assistance.
